- The distance between Brighton, England, Uk and Cologne, Germany is approximately 498 km or 310 mi.
- To reach Brighton, England in this distance one would set out from Cologne bearing 270.8° or W and follow the great circles arc to approach Brighton, England bearing 265.3° or W .
- Both have a marine west coast climate (Cfb).
- Both are in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
- The average temperature is 0 °C (0.1°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 4 °C (7.2°F) less in Brighton, England.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 93 mm (3.7 in) more which is equivalent to 93 l/m² (2.28 US gal/ft²) or 930,000 l/ha (99,423 US gal/ac) more. About 1 1/8 as much.
- There are 314 more hours of sunlight per year in Brighton, England. In whichever way circa 0h 51' more per day or about 1 2/9 as many.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 0.1° higher in Brighton, England than in Cologne.
